Output d175f68c22e82ca6851cd08efcc3ed9be2fc2b8ca7bbd8b0b2eddf3355d84832:29

value
1087046
script pubkey
OP_0 OP_PUSHBYTES_20 3d73b6c7756a0958c4c7b180befc91f6443cb490
address
bc1q84emd3m4dgy433x8kxqtaly37ezredysxd4v0h
transaction
d175f68c22e82ca6851cd08efcc3ed9be2fc2b8ca7bbd8b0b2eddf3355d84832
spent
true